Sniper Alley is the UNSC codename for a location on the Forerunner shield world Requiem.[1]

History

The area known as Sniper Alley on Requiem

The Sniper Alley location is an area on Requiem that leads to the power core for the planet's Particle cannon network and the AI personality of theLibrarian. John-117 entered the area to neutralize the particle cannon network to allow him to reach and destroy the Gravity well holding the UNSC Infinity on the planet. After clearing Unggoy and Kig-Yar from the area, John-117 faced Promethean forces. He managed to defeat all of them and progress within the structure and disable the network.[2]

Six months later Covenant remnant forces had put up an energy source and were drawing energy from the Forerunner mechanisms within the planet. The UNSC Infinitysent in Fireteam Crimson to locate the power source and eliminate the Covenant in the area. Crimson was successful and an air strike was conducted, destroying the generator. Crimson then was extracted from the area.[3] Later en route to the Refuge, Crimson's Pelican was shot down by Covenent-run Forerunner anti-air turrets. Crimson managed to survive, clear Covenant from the location yet again, and disable the turrets. Crimson then contrinued to the Refuge.[4] Despite their two defeats, the Covenant did not give up on the location and re-established a presence, secretly communicating by using a generator in Sniper Alley. Once again, Fireteam Crimson had to eliminate ther Covenant at the location and destroy their target prior to extraction.[5]

Trivia

  • The name may be a reference to Halo 2's level Outskirts, where an especially challenging section filled with Kig-Yar Snipers was dubbed by players as "Sniper Alley".
  • The back of the canyon is closed off for gameplay reasons in Spartan Ops.
